Salvia verticillata 'Endless Love' PP21707

Common Name: Perennial Salvia, Whorled Sage

This selection of perennial salvia features violet blue flower spikes atop compact, upright plants.  It blooms for many weeks beginning in early summer, and the flowering period can be extended into late summer if plants are cut back after the first flush of blooms. 

The coarse, green foliage forms an outwardly spreading clump in the landscape.

This is a clump forming perennial with oblong leaves which are aromatic when crushed. The flowers add great texture and fragrance to both fresh and dried bouquets. Use this plant in containers or the middle of the flower border.
